In high school, the school has responsibilities which include the following:
Provide assessment of students with disabilities Identify students with disabilities Classify disabilities according to specified diagnostic categories Provide a free and appropriate education Develop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) Involve parents or guardians in educational decisions Place students in appropriate programs where they receive educational benefit with parent participation and approval in the planning and placement team (PPT) process Provide related services (i.e., speech, OT/PT, school nurse or health service) Modify educational program as appropriate The post-secondary level institutional role changes as follows:
Accept and evaluate verifying documentation Determine that a mental or physical impairment causes a substantial limitation of a major life activity based on student-provided verifying documents Determine whether students are otherwise qualified for participation in the program or service, with or without accommodations, and if so, whether a reasonable accommodation is possible Inform students of office location and procedures for requesting accommodations Inform students of their rights and responsibilities Make reasonable accommodations for students who meet the above qualifying criteria Provide access to programs and services which are offered to persons without disabilities Provide reasonable access to program and service choices equal to those available to the general public Make reasonable adjustments in teaching methods which do not alter the essential content of a course or program Assure that off-campus and contracted program facilities also comply with Section 504 and ADA (Other differences may exist for post-secondary institutions which provide housing programs, health services, psychological counseling services, and extensive international programs.)
